ROGERS v. STATE

No. 27819.

289 S.W.2d 923 (1956)

Charles ROGERS, Appellant, v. The STATE of Texas, Appellee.

Court of Criminal Appeals of Texas.

On Motion for Rehearing April 4, 1956.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Sam L. Harrison, San Antonio, for appellant.

John F. May, Dist. Atty., Karnes City, and Leon B. Douglas, State's Atty., Austin, for the State.


MORRISON, Presiding Judge.

The offense is the unlawful fondling of the breast of a female under the age of fourteen years; the punishment, 5 years.

Our original opinion is withdrawn.

No statement of facts accompanies the record.
